SOLEFALD Neonism (1999) CD
1999 was a strange year to be a black metal band that wanted to talk about Nietzsche, technology, and the collapse of meaning, but Solefald had never really asked for permission anyway.
Neonism is the Norwegian duo's second album and one of the more genuinely weird entries in the late-90s avant-garde black metal canon. Where their debut flirted with the experimental, Neonism went fully off-script, folding in jazz textures, spoken word, clean vocals, and an almost industrial coldness into something that shouldn't work but absolutely does. Cornelius Jakhelln and Lazare were operating in the same orbit as Arcturus and Ved Buens Ende, artists who understood that black metal was a starting point, not a ceiling. This 2007 repress on Season of Mist keeps the original tracklist intact, including the essential sprawl of Philosophical Revolt and the unsettling closer Proprietaire de Monde.
